CHAPTER 6

COMPUTATIONAL APPLICATIONS

This chapter is intended to illustrate the use of field-programmable gate arrays (FPGAs) in computational applications. The following topics are covered:

  • The state of the art in FPGA computers
  • The Algotronix CHS2×4 Custom Computer
  • Example applications:
    1. Data Encryption Standard
    2. Self-timed first-in first-out buffer
    3. Self-timed genetic string distance evaluation
    4. Cellular automaton
    5. Place-and-route acceleration
    6. Motion estimation

Get Field-Programmable Gate Arrays: Reconfigurable Logic for Rapid Prototyping and Implementation of Digital Systems now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.